Certain answers to these

questions will be flagged

for denial in an

automated system,

saving agents time by

automatically flagging

unqualified leads.

The automated decision making system removes agent bias from approving or denying a case’s viability. The system uses the qualifying questions as black and white “points” for or against the case’s approval.
